如何确定服务器cpu需要几核

不及物动词 其他 62

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    确定服务器CPU需要几核的问题,主要取决于以下几个因素:

    1.应用程序的性质:不同的应用程序对CPU的需求是不同的。例如,一些需要大量计算的科学计算应用程序可能需要多个核心来处理复杂的计算任务,而一些简单的网络服务应用程序可能只需要较少的核心。

    2.负载预测:根据你的应用程序的负载情况来预测所需的CPU核心数。可以通过监控和分析实际使用情况来进行负载预测,以确定所需的核心数量。

    3.可扩展性需求:如果你的应用程序具有潜在的扩展需求,即在未来需要增加用户或业务量时,可以考虑选择更多核心。这样可以确保服务器的性能在未来的扩展中不会受到限制。

    4.预算限制:服务器的CPU核心数通常与价格成正比。因此,在决定服务器的CPU核心数时,你需要考虑你的预算限制,并权衡性能和成本之间的平衡。

    综上所述,确定服务器CPU需要几核的关键是考虑应用程序的性质、负载预测、可扩展性需求和预算限制。同时,可以通过与供应商和专业人员咨询,以及参考类似应用程序的实际使用情况来帮助做出决策。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    确定服务器CPU需要几核可以根据以下几个因素来进行判断:

    1. 预估负载:根据预计的服务器负载情况来确定CPU核心数量。负载与CPU核心数量之间存在一定的关联,更高的负载通常需要更多的核心来处理。可以根据每个请求的平均处理时间,每秒处理请求数以及每个请求占用的CPU资源来估计负载情况。

    2. 应用需求:不同的应用对CPU核心数量的需求可能不同。例如,一些处理密集型应用(如图像处理、科学计算)通常需要更多的核心来提供更高的性能,而一些较简单的应用(如Web服务器)可能只需要少数几个核心就能正常运行。

    3. 并发连接数:如果服务器需要处理大量的并发连接,那么可能需要更多的CPU核心来同时处理这些连接。对于高并发的应用(如游戏服务器、实时流媒体服务器),需要更多的核心来避免性能瓶颈。

    4. 可扩展性:考虑到未来的发展需求,选择具有较高可扩展性的CPU。如果预计将来需要增加服务器负载或并发连接数,那么选择具有更多核心的CPU可以提供更好的可扩展性。

    5. 预算限制:根据可用预算来确定合适的CPU。更多核心的CPU通常比较昂贵,因此需要在预算范围内进行权衡,并确保选取的CPU能够满足它所需的性能。

    需要注意的是,以上只是一些参考因素,并不是确定CPU核心数量的绝对指标。实际上,最好的方法是通过对服务器进行压力测试和性能评估来确定最适合的CPU配置。这可以确保服务器能够提供所需的性能,同时避免浪费资源或造成低效的情况。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    确定服务器 CPU 需要几核的方法有以下几种:

    1. 计算服务器负载:

      • 首先,你需要了解你的服务器将要运行的应用程序或服务的负载情况。负载是指服务器处理任务的能力需求。可以通过以下方式来确定负载情况:
        • 分析历史数据:查看历史数据,包括CPU使用率、内存使用率、网络流量等指标,以了解系统的负载情况。可以使用监控工具或通过系统日志来获取这些数据。
        • 做容量规划:预测未来的负载需求,包括用户数量、并发请求数、数据量等。可以通过市场调研、需求分析、业务规划等来预测。
        • 做压力测试:模拟实际使用情况,在不同负载条件下测试服务器的性能。
    2. 考虑服务器的用途和任务类型:

      • 不同的应用程序和任务类型对 CPU 需求不同。例如,如果你的服务器将主要用于处理高并发的网络请求,那么需要选择拥有更多核心的 CPU 来处理请求。而如果是用于处理大数据计算任务,则需要更多的 CPU 核心以加快计算速度。
      • 同时,还需要考虑服务器是否需要同时运行多个任务。如果是,那么需要选择更强大的 CPU。
    3. 了解 CPU 的指标:

      • 在选择服务器 CPU 时,还需要了解 CPU 的一些指标,如主频、核心数、缓存等级等。主频是指 CPU 的运行速度,频率越高,处理速度越快。核心数决定 CPU 的并行处理能力,核心数越多,可以同时处理的任务越多。缓存是 CPU 内部用于存储临时数据的区域,缓存越大,数据读取速度越快。
    4. 参考同类服务器的配置:

      • 可以参考同类服务器的配置信息,了解他们的 CPU 配置情况。可以通过各大厂商的官网、论坛、社区等获取这些信息。
    5. 咨询专业人员:

      • 如果你对服务器配置不太了解,或者对几核的 CPU 选择有疑问,可以咨询专业人员,如服务器供应商、硬件工程师或系统管理员,他们可以给予你专业的建议和指导。

    需要注意的是,在选择 CPU 的过程中,除了核心数,还需要综合考虑其他因素,如价格、功耗、支持的指令集、性能调整等,以满足服务器的整体需求。最好可以根据具体的情况做一些实际测试和验证,以确保最终选择的 CPU 符合服务器的要求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部